The global Laue Camera market is projected to grow from US$ 372 million in 2025 to US$ 586 million by 2032, at a CAGR of 6.8% (2026-2032), driven by critical product segments and diverse end‑use applications, while evolving U.S. tariff policies introduce trade‑cost volatility and supply‑chain uncertainty.
In 2024, the global production of Laue cameras was 1,250 units, with an average price of US$280,000 per unit.
A Laue camera is an instrument used to determine the orientation and symmetry of single crystals using the Laue diffraction method, which employs a polychromatic (white) X-ray beam to create a unique diffraction pattern. These patterns are recorded on a detector or film and are then analyzed by software to find the crystal's orientation, which is crucial for applications like cutting crystals for use in electronics or other industries. Modern Laue cameras often use digital detectors for faster, real-time results compared to older film-based systems.
The upstream supply chain of Laue cameras primarily consists of suppliers of X-ray sources, detector chips, high-purity metal optical components, and radiation-shielding materials. Typical companies include Hamamatsu, Amptek, Comet, Moxtek, and the sensing component division of Shimadzu Corporation. Downstream customers are concentrated in research laboratories and materials companies. MIT, Tsinghua University, ETH Zurich, Fraunhofer, and national materials research institutions worldwide are typical users in the research sector, demanding extremely high stability in crystal orientation measurement, spatial resolution, and the ability to identify weak diffraction signals. Downstream in the industrial sector mainly includes semiconductor wafer manufacturers, aerospace metal component companies, and new materials companies, such as GlobalWafers, II-VI, GE Aviation, Airbus Materials, and carbon fiber composite companies. They rely on Laue cameras for crystal orientation screening, incoming material acceptance, and component stress analysis to ensure the consistency of high-performance materials.
With the increasing complexity of advanced materials and semiconductor processes, the demand for Laue cameras continues to grow. Industry trends are characterized by the accelerated application of high dynamic range detectors, automated angle measurement, and AI diffraction pattern recognition technologies, transforming the equipment from a research tool to a rapid online industrial inspection system. The driving factors include the increased requirements for crystal orientation consistency due to the larger size of semiconductor wafers, the increased demand in aerospace for detecting internal stress and crystal orientation deviations in single-crystal nickel-based alloy and titanium alloy components, and the growth in procurement of basic scientific research equipment driven by the large-scale construction of university laboratories. The hindering factors mainly include the rising cost of high-performance X-ray detectors, long equipment integration cycles, radiation safety management requirements during use, and the highly specialized nature of Laue diffraction data analysis, leading to high training and after-sales costs.
Laue cameras are small-batch, high-precision devices; a mature production line typically produces 150 to 300 units annually, with gross profit margins consistently maintained between 35% and 50%.

Laue cameras use a technique that exploits back-reflection geometry. A beam of polychromatic low-energy X-rays passes through a detector and a sample on the other side of the detector, which reflects the X-ray beam and forms a set of diffraction spots. These diffraction spots are then recorded directly onto the detector. The indexing of the diffraction pattern is specific for each crystal orientation and allows materials scientists and physicists to grow and then cut crystals with electro-optical properties.
